Islamic belief
Samad reiterates to Chester the information concerning his religion. He explains to Chester, for example, that 'khalwat' is a prohibited thing to do, particularly among unmarried people. By saying that those who have done 'khalwat' will transcend to hell, he even broaches the subject more deeply.
